Penguins' Staal out 4-6 weeks, Neal has broken foot
The Pittsburgh Penguins received a double dose of bad news on Sunday.
Center Jordan Staal is expected to miss four to six weeks with a knee injury and leading goal-scorer James Neal will be sidelined indefinitely with a broken foot.
Staal was injured on a knee-on-knee hit from New York Rangers veteran Mike Rupp on Friday night.

Penguins Lose Two More Key Players To Injuries
from Sam Kasan at the Penguins website, Center Jordan Staal is out 4-6 weeks with a knee injury after he collided knee-on-knee with Rangers forward Mike Rupp Friday night, according to head coach Dan Bylsma. Staal will not need surgery.

Neal out with broken foot; Staal to miss 4-6 weeks
Right wing James Neal, whose 21 goals are fifth in the NHL, sustained a broken foot against New Jersey on Saturday. The Penguins also suffered a possibly significant injury in practice on Sunday when Craig Adams sustained a right knee injury.

Pens' Neal, Adams say they're ready to play tonight
The Penguins got some welcome and unexpected medical news today, as forwards James Neal (foot) and Craig Adams pronounced themselves ready to return to the lineup for tonight's game against Ottawa at Consol Energy Center.
